How far is Washington, D.C. Reagan-National to New York by plane?
New York is 208.4 mi away from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National. Typically, this will take 1h 07m by plane in normal conditions.

How old do you have to be to fly from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to New York?
Although the minimum age for a child to fly alone is five, airlines that offer an unaccompanied minor (UMNR) service may have their own age limits, which could be impacted by factors such as flight length, timing, and layovers. It is recommended that you verify with the airline you are booking with for travel from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to New York.

What is the most popular plane model from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to New York?
Based on momondo bookings for flights between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port and New York, the leading plane model is Embraer 175, making up 18.52% of the total bookings. Other popular models include Canadair (Bombardier) Regional Jet 900 with 8.28%, Boeing 777 with 8.21%, and Airbus A220-300 with 6.40%.
What is the most popular airline from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to New York?
momondo data reveals that the most frequently booked airline on the route from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to New York is American Airlines, representing 35% of all bookings. The subsequent popular airlines are Delta at 32%, United Airlines at 24%, and JetBlue at 9%.
